How Does the Trade-In Process Work?

Trading in your laptop at Best Buy is an uncomplicated process. Follow these essential steps to maximize your experience:

  1. Check Eligibility: Not all laptops are eligible for trade-in. Ensure your device meets Best Buy’s minimum requirements. Typically, devices need to be less than ten years old and in good working condition.
  2. Get a Value Estimate: Before heading to the store, you can use Best Buy’s online trade-in estimator. Simply enter your laptop’s brand, model, and condition to receive an initial estimate.
  3. Bring Your Device: Head to your nearest Best Buy store with your laptop. Ensure it’s reset to factory settings and remove all personal data.
  4. Trade-In Assessment: Once in-store, a Best Buy employee will physically inspect your laptop. They will evaluate its condition and confirm whether it meets the criteria for the estimated trade-in value.
  5. Receive Store Credit: If everything checks out, you’ll receive store credit that can be applied toward a new purchase, making it easier to upgrade your tech.

What to Expect: Limitations and Conditions

Every trade-in program has limitations, and Best Buy is no exception. Here’s what you should be aware of:

1. Condition of the Laptop

Your laptop must be in good working condition to receive a meaningful trade-in value. Damaged or non-functioning devices may not be accepted, and even if they are, the value will be significantly lower.

2. Age Restrictions

Generally, Best Buy prefers laptops that are less than ten years old. If your laptop is older than this, it’s likely that the trade-in value will be minimal, if accepted at all.

3. Trade-In Limits

Best Buy may impose limits on the number of devices you can trade in at one time. Therefore, if you have several laptops to trade, check the policy beforehand.

4. Store Credit Only

It’s crucial to understand that the trade-in value comes in the form of store credit, not cash. If you’re looking for cash in hand, you may need to consider alternative methods for selling your device.

What condition does my laptop need to be in to trade it in?

Best Buy accepts laptops that are in good working condition, meaning they should power on and hold a charge. The screen should be free from major scratches, cracks, or any display issues, and all essential components should be functioning properly, including the keyboard and trackpad.

However, laptops with significant damage or those that do not power on may not qualify for trade-in, or might yield a reduced value. It’s always best to assess your laptop’s condition honestly before trading it in.
